Data: The suspected Binance-controlled address holdings have increased to 147 million coins, accounting for 14.67% of the total

According to crypto analyst Yu Jin @EmberCN, approximately 87.85 million Binance Life (worth about 14.93 million USD) was previously transferred out of Binance through 9 wallets by suspected related addresses, after which the price of Binance Life rose by about 59%.

Currently, the suspected related addresses collectively hold approximately 146.7 million Binance Life on-chain, accounting for about 14.67% of the total supply, corresponding to a value of about 39.8 million USD.
